Top Learning Platforms You Must Know

When online learning or e-learning solutions first appeared in the late 90s, they were considered a hobbyist’s muse – exciting perhaps, but not effective modes of learning. Fast forward to 2020, 50% of the higher education students have taken at least one online course in the past year. 

Online learning platforms have come a long way in the past two decades, especially after the arrival of massive open online courses (MOOCs) in 2008. They completely revolutionized the e-learning space for millions of students, professionals, and organizations worldwide. Inspired by their immense popularity, even traditional institutions, like Harvard, MIT, Princeton, Stanford, and others, are launching e-learning courses, specializations, and even online degrees. 

Naturally, the online learning market is predicted to grow into a staggering $325 billion industry by 2025.

But which online learning platform is best suited for you?

Should you choose a free platform or a premium platform?

Which e-learning platform will help you build a successful career in the field of your choice?

We’ll answer these and many more questions in this brief guide on online learning platforms.

Before we start, you must understand that each e-learning platform has its own set of approaches to educating its users, monetizing the platform, and preparing you for your dream career. There is no one super-awesome platform that offers everything. However, each of them is an excellent choice for a unique set of people with a unique set of requirements. 

All Learning Platforms We Have Reviewed:

Here’s how you can find a platform and course that offers you the best value for your time and money.

How To Select the Right Online Learning Platform?

The enormous number of online learning resources out there can confuse anyone looking for high-quality educational content online. Here are some tips for finding the right platform for your needs:

  • Topics

Obviously, you must choose a platform that offers you good-quality courses in the field of your choice. For instance, CreativeLive focuses on creative subjects, while Datacamp focuses on data analytics and data science. Find a platform that offers courses relevant to you.

  • Level of Expertise

Depth is not the only criterion to consider here. You must select a platform that offers courses that match your proficiency. If you are a beginner, you don’t want to land on a platform whose programs are designed only for advanced learners, and vice versa.

  • Pricing

Of course, pricing matters. If you are on a budget, then Coursera, Udemy, and EDX are good choices. 

  • Engagement

Some platforms offer interactive learning experiences by employing projects, quizzes, exams, assignments, community membership, and more. Other platforms offer simple video-based courses with little interaction between instructor and students. Choose the platform that works best for you.

  • Course Quality

Platforms like Coursera, EDX, Datacamp, CreativeLive, Pluralsight, and Skillshare offer high-quality courses across the board. On other platforms like Udemy, Udacity, and so on, the quality varies significantly between courses. You can still choose the latter kind of resources, so long as you are ready to invest some time researching the courses and finding the best one for your needs.

8 Best Online Learning Platforms 

Now that you know the most important factors you must consider when selecting the right e-learning platform for yourself, it’s time to check out the top ones. This guide is designed to help you find out which platform is the best option for you. Let’s get started.

1. Coursera: Best Online Learning Platform For Accredited Education

Coursera is one of the oldest and most popular online learning platforms for professionals. It features individual courses, multi-course specializations, and online degrees from some of the top universities in the world, including Yale, Stanford, Duke, and so on. Naturally, the platform’s courses have been accessed by over 50 million students since its inception. 

If you want a robust understanding of the subject in which you are interested, and need some accreditations to prove your job-worthiness to your employer, then Coursera is the right platform for you.


  • You can join most courses on Coursera for free, although you must purchase the program to get a certification of completion. 
  • Coursera’s certifications tend to hold value among many employers
  • It offers an abundance of certifications and accreditation from top universities – more than any other platform
  • The platform also offers courses from top companies like Google, IBM, and so on.
  • You can find courses and programs on almost all academic topics here
  • Coursera is partnered with several international universities. So, you can find courses in many different languages


  • Most of these courses are targeted at advanced learners, such as higher education students. So, some level of familiarity is required in the field of study

Read in-depth review of Coursera here.

2. Udemy: Best E-learning Platform For the Voracious Learner

Udemy offers one of the largest repositories of educational content to online students all over the world. It enjoys a massive userbase of over 12 million learners, who can access over 100,000 courses on the platform. The sheer variety of educational content available on Udemy is astounding. Whatever you want to learn, there’s likely a course for it on Udemy.


  • Over 100,000 courses on a wide variety of topics
  • Courses designed for every kind of learner – from beginner to advanced
  • Courses are rated and reviewed by users. So, you know what to expect
  • Plenty of free courses available. Most premium courses have low prices. All premium courses go on sale frequently. 
  • 30-day moneyback guarantee lets you request a refund if you don’t like a course


  • Content creation is not as standardized as that of Coursera. Course designers can be anyone from a hobbyist to a specialist. So, the quality of courses varies significantly from one to another
  • No interaction between the students and the teacher
  • No certifications or accreditations available 

3. Skillshare: Best Online Education Platform for Creative Beginners

Skillshare e-learning platform open on laptop.

Skillshare is the ultimate learning platform for creative minds. They offer courses on everything from graphic design to music production, photography, and cooking. Although they have classes on technical topics like eCommerce and data science, creative education is where they shine over the others.

Its strong focus on creative topics has made it the e-learning platform of choice for over 5 million students worldwide. 


  • Over 25,000 courses on a variety of topics available 
  • Subscription-based pricing charges you a flat fee (monthly or yearly) and gives you complete access to all the courses on the platform
  • Roughly 10% of the courses on the platform are free
  • Courses available from some of the world’s biggest brands like Google and Mailchimp
  • The platform uses a mix of lessons, assignments, and prompts to engage the learner.
  • A community forum allows subscribers to interact, showcase their progress, get feedback on their work, and hone their skills


  • Although international language courses are available, it’s primarily an English-focused platform
  • No certifications or accreditations available 
  • The quality of courses varies significantly depending on the course designer, as almost everyone is allowed to create classes on the platform

Read in-depth review of Skillshare here.

4. CreativeLive: Best Online Courses Platform for Creative Pros

Unlike Skillshare, CreativeLive is squarely targeted at creative professionals and entrepreneurs. The educational content on CreativeLive is quite advanced and offers the learners in-depth insights into the fields of their interest. 

The courses are created by some of the biggest names in the respective industries, including the likes of Grammy award winners, Oscar award winners, and bestselling authors. CreativeLive is where you can level up your skills and bring them on par with the industry experts. So, it’s hardly any surprise that the platform boasts over 10 million users.


  • All courses are filmed by in-house videographers, so the quality of video courses is superb
  • The courses offer actionable tips to help professionals progress in their fields
  • Premium courses tend to be available at deeply discounted prices most of the time. Also, the creator passes allow you to access multiple programs simultaneously
  • Courses are created by the world’s best professionals, such as Grammy award winners, Oscar award winners, and bestselling authors
  • All courses are free at the time of their live streaming
  • 30-day moneyback policy (7-day for creator pass)


  • The course pricing can often be relatively high as they are created by the crème de la crème of the industry
  • Creator pass subscribers retain access to courses as long as they continue to renew their premium subscription

Read in-depth review of CreativeLive here.

5. Codecademy: Best Online Learning Platform For Aspiring Coders

Codecademy is inarguably the best coding platform for beginners. Codecademy offers courses on all programming languages, be it frontend technologies or backend technologies. If you are starting from scratch and want to develop solid fundamentals of coding, then you cannot go wrong with this online learning platform. After all, it’s trusted by over 45 million users. 

You will find courses on HTML, CSS, .Net, Python, Sass, Ruby, and many other programming languages on Codecademy. Many aspiring coders encounter complex and advanced coding concepts at the beginning of their learning journey, which often discourages them from pursuing a career as a developer. Thankfully, Codecademy’s courses ease you into the field, excites you with tantalizing problems, and hones your coding skills as per your proficiency level. 


  • Courses are designed for learners at all stages in their learning journey
  • You can apply your newfound knowledge by actively coding on the platform. You’re even provided instant feedback on your code 
  • Most of the beginner-friendly classes are entirely free, although advanced classes require a subscription
  • Premium subscription comes with the certifications of completion
  • Codecademy uses a mix of quizzes and real-life projects to get you “market-ready” 
  • The friendly community of coaches, fellow students, and advisors share their knowledge, experience, and advice to help you improve


  • Although courses are professionally created, there’s very little information shared about the instructors
  • Its certifications are not accredited by any third parties.

6. Pluralsight: Best E-learning Platform for Coding Professionals

Think of Pluralsight as ‘Codecademy on steroids.’ It’s the go-to platform for top-of-the-class coders and businesses looking for high-quality education on IT topics. In fact, over 70% of the Fortune 500 companies have accounts on Pluralsight – a fact that the platform proudly boasts on its website. 

The courses on Pluralsight are created by over 1,500+ industry experts with a strong background in their respective areas. Whether you plan to improve your expertise in cybersecurity, coding, software development, mobile app development, or other IT areas, Pluralsight has just the right courses to help you realize your career goals. 


  • High-quality courses created by the industry’s most reputed experts
  • Trusted by companies like Microsoft, Adobe, Google, Oracle, and others
  • Learning experiences are tailored to your current proficiency. And yes, they test your skills before getting started
  • Higher-level premium plans offer projects, interactive courses, certifications, integrations, analytics, and other advanced features


  • It’s quite expensive, especially when you consider the higher plans
  • No free plans or courses
  • The platform focuses on specialized topics. If you’re looking for a broader understanding of the subject, then Pluralsight is not for you.

7. Datacamp: Best Online Learning Resource for Aspiring and Professional Data Scientists

Okay. This is the final technical education platform on our list. Datacamp deserves a special mention because it’s an outstanding resource on data science and analytics. Datacamp does not leave any stone unturned in getting students up to speed on everything related to the topic. The courses take them from the beginner’s stage right to the point of an expert. If you are looking to pursue a career in big data, artificial intelligence, data analytics, data science, and related fields, then Datacamp could be just what you need.


  • The platform emphasizes interactive learning, which means that the students are more engaged and invested in their learning journey
  • Datacamp courses break down complex topics into bite-sized content that is easy to digest
  • Courses are created by over 270 experts from the industry
  • Simple and transparent pricing
  • Courses are designed for everyone from beginners to advanced learners
  • They use both video classes and exercises to engage the online students 


  • Free plan available, but it gives you access to only the first lesson in each course. So, all courses require you to pay if you’d like to access the rest of the lessons 
  • Certificates are available on competition but are not accredited

8. edX: Best Online Education Platform for Academic Learning

To put it in simple terms, EDX is the best Coursera-alternative out there. 

Just like Coursera, EDX also features courses and programs from some of the largest corporations and universities in the world. It hosts over 25 million online students and hundreds of top universities. Students can join individual courses, Master’s degrees, and everything in between.

The best part about EDX is that its courses are often accepted towards college credits by several institutions worldwide. However, students should inquire about this at their university and make sure that their institution accepts EDX credits towards their specialization.


  • Courses designed by universities like MIT, Berkeley, Harvard, Boson University, and so on
  • All courses are free for everyone
  • You can start courses anytime you like and complete them at your own pace
  • The quality of the content is top-notch, as they are created by some of the best universities and corporations
  • You can get accredited certifications with your photo and ID for a premium. However, certifications offered for free plan users do not mention such specifics and hold little value, if any


  • Course difficulty varies substantially from one to another, but most courses require basic knowledge of the respective field
  • Each course is usually available for a limited period

Read our in-depth edX review here.

So, did you find the perfect online learning platform for your needs?

Get Started Today

Get Started with Online Education & Learning.

Have a career dream? Get working on it now!

CreativeLive offers creative courses that help students acquire a wide variety of skills, including music production, video production, graphics design, web design, branding, finance, management, and more. 

Elevate your skills with the help of some of the most accomplished instructors in different industries and world-class educational content curated by them. Try CreativeLive today for free.